FBC Cedar Key Church Covenant 

Our Covenant traces from Scripture a picture of how we agree to live and abbreviates the Biblical doctrines that shape the life and ministry of FBC Cedar Key. 

Having been led, as we believe, by the Spirit of God, to receive the Lord Jesus Christ as our Savior, and, on the profession of our faith, having been baptized in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it,  we do now, in the presence of God, angels and this assembly, most solemnly and joyfully covenant with one another as one body in Christ.
We endeavor, therefore, by the aid of the Holy Spirit, to walk together in Christian love, to strive for the advancement of this church in knowledge and holiness; to promote its prosperity and spirituality; to sustain its worship, ordinances, discipline and doctrines; to contribute cheerfully, sacrificially, and regularly to the support of the ministry, the expenses of the church, the relief of the poor, the aid of widows and orphans, and the spread of the gospel to all nations.

We also endeavor to maintain family and personal devotions; to educate our children in the Christian faith; to seek the salvation of our kindred and acquaintances; to live in the world but not of it; to be just in our dealings, faithful in our engagements, and exemplary in our conduct, to avoid all gossip, backbiting and excessive anger; to seek God’s help in abstaining from practices that bring unwarranted harm to the body or jeopardize our own or another’s faith. We also will not forsake the gathering of ourselves.
We further endeavor to watch over one another in brotherly love; to pray for and seek unity at all times; to live at peace with all as far as it depends on us; to remember one another in prayer; to aid one another in sickness and distress; to cultivate Christian sympathy in feeling and courtesy in speech; to be slow to take offense, but always ready for reconciliation and mindful of the guidelines of our Savior to secure it without delay.

We moreover endeavor that when we move from this place, we will, if possible, unite with a church where we can carry out the articles of this confession and the spirit of this covenant.
